At Long Last - Surrey Beat Kent - Blackheath 1923

Star Item

Description

Blackheath, London. 30/07/1923 ?

Full title reads: At Long Last! Surrey - chiefly by "Percy" Fender's brilliant captaincy and "Bill" Hitch's demon bowling - beat Kent for first time at Blackheath.

Begins with shot of players leaving the field as there is a pitch invasion - no shots...
